[QUOTE="ferrarr, post: 1863928, member: 376394"] Since you have a current Time Machine backup, you should create a bootable USB and erase/wipe/format the drive. Then bring everything back from Time Machine. See this, [URL]https://support.apple.com/en-us/HT201372[/URL] You need to start clean on both the ac, and the Time Machine backup. So first restore your Mac, and all your data from Time machine, then erase/format/wipe Time Machine and start new again. [/QUOTE]
